In Gemfire for the SNES, you step into a captivating world where strategy and conquest intertwine. As the ruler of a kingdom, your goal is to unite the realm by defeating rival clans through tactical warfare and clever diplomacy. The game blends turn-based strategy with real-time battles, allowing you to command your troops on the battlefield and engage in intense skirmishes. You'll manage resources, recruit powerful warriors, and develop unique abilities to strengthen your forces.
One of the standout features of Gemfire is its deep political system, where alliances can be forged or broken with a single decision. Each character possesses distinct skills and attributes, giving you plenty of options to create a balanced army. The difficulty ramps up as you progress, challenging even seasoned strategy fans to think critically about their next move.
